Art. 288 Continuation of the proceedings and decision
1 If the conditions for a divorce at joint request are fulfilled, the court shall decree the divorce and approve the agreement. 2 If the effects of the divorce remain disputed, the proceedings shall be continued with regard to these effects under adversarial procedure.141 The court may assign the roles of plaintiff and defendant. 3 If the requirements for divorce at joint request are not met, the court shall reject the joint request for divorce and at the same time set a deadline to each spouse for the filing of a divorce action.142 The proceedings remain pending during this period and any interim measures continue to apply. 141 Amended by No II of the FA of 25 Sept. 2009 (Period for reflection in Divorce Proceedings on Joint Application), in force since 1 Jan. 2011 (AS 2010 2811861; BBl 2008 19591975). 142 Amended by No II of the FA of 25 Sept. 2009 (Period for reflection in Divorce Proceedings on Joint Application), in force since 1 Jan. 2011 (AS 2010 2811861; BBl 2008 19591975). |
